Respecting Other Players

One of the cornerstones of casino etiquette is showing respect towards fellow players. Whether you are playing at a table game or enjoying slots, it’s vital to maintain a friendly and courteous demeanor. Avoid discussing strategy or making comments that could offend other players. Remember, everyone is there to enjoy themselves, and creating a welcoming environment helps everyone have a better time.

Additionally, if you need to step away from a table, be sure to inform the dealer and your fellow players. Leaving abruptly can disrupt the game and lead to frustration. Simple gestures, such as keeping conversations at a reasonable volume and not blocking pathways, contribute significantly to a respectful atmosphere within the casino.

Interacting with Casino Staff

Casino staff, including dealers and attendants, play a vital role in ensuring that games run smoothly and guests have a pleasant experience. When interacting with them, always be polite and patient. If you have questions or need assistance, approach them respectfully. A friendly demeanor not only fosters a positive atmosphere but also encourages staff to provide better service.

Additionally, tipping is a common practice in casinos. If you receive exceptional service, consider showing your appreciation through a tip. This small gesture can go a long way in building goodwill and ensuring a pleasant interaction with the staff throughout your gaming experience.

Game-Specific Etiquette

Different games come with their own sets of rules and etiquette. For instance, at table games like blackjack or poker, it’s essential to familiarize yourself with the game rules and player etiquette. Make sure to wait for your turn and handle chips or cards according to the established norms. Knowing when to act and how to engage with the game and other players shows respect for the game’s flow.

For slot machine players, while the atmosphere is generally more relaxed, it’s still important to be aware of others around you. Avoid hovering too closely over someone else’s machine, as it can create discomfort. Respect the personal space of fellow players, and maintain a friendly attitude towards all participants in the gaming experience.
